Abstract
In mobile communication, normally communication is intended to establish between
the transmitter and receiver under the scenario where the transmitter / receiver or both
having their respective movements, the consequence of the relative motion of receiver
is to introduce a Doppler shift in the received frequency which in turn making the
frequency components received as time-variant. This non-stationary behavior of the
signal enforced the analysis of the signal to be performed in time-frequency plane.
The fractional Fourier transform (FrFT), which is also known as generalization of
Fourier transform (FT), has been established as a better mathematical tool to tackle
this state of affair of the signal.The proposed work can be divided into two broader segments. The first segment
includes the efforts made in establishing the translation invariance concept of
fractional convolution and correlation to show that these are no more partial invariant
by expanding some convolution and correlation related identities. The second segment comprises the filtering application in FrFT. The beneficial role of
the FrFT in the filtering application lies in the capability of the FrFT in localizing the
non-stationary (chirp) signals in time-frequency plane. This ascertains the superiority
of FrFT domain filtering over time-domain and frequency domain filtering in the case
of overlapping band limited signal and noise. Thus, FrFT proved to be a better
technique in the context to other transformation techniques.
